Does Britain have the worst journalism in the world ?

by reiverman @ 06/04/2008 - 23:26:32

Following the Express admitting to spewing out a load of lies about the McCanns, is it a fact that most British journalism is appalling bad ?
When you think about the balls of slime like Richard Littlejohn, Piers Morgan, Kelvin Mckenzie etc that our newspaper industry has produced it doesn't say much for the rest of them.
The likes of the The Sun, the Daily Wail, Star etc seem to survive on negativity, sensationalism and scaremongering.
They seem to have power without responsibility.
And the low quality seems to have spread to TV and so called quality newspapers as well.
But ultimatley is it our
fault for buying this rubbish ?
